508869434061494649132035
Barcode
Odd
508869434061494649132035 is odd
Previous odd number is 508869434061494649132033
Next odd number is 508869434061494649132037
Hexadecimal
Binary
1101011110000011101111000000111000111010001111000101011001100001001010000000011
Cubed
131770773567510450114893179481397803502349864390146841184597913080142875